Seneca Holdings has an immediate opening for a Senior Contracts Manager supporting our Mission Services sector business activities. This role will serve as a senior member of Seneca's Contracting, Legal and Ethics and Compliance (CLEC) organization, and will report to Seneca's Mission Services Sector Director of Contracting.

The Senior Contracts Manager is a key member of Seneca's CLEC team, responsible for ensuring Seneca Holdings subsidiaries within the Mission Services sector comply with federal procurement laws, effectively manage business risk, and support efficient and profitable business performance.

The Senior Contracts Manager works independently and provides contractual and procurement support to the Mission Services company presidents, program managers, and business development leadership. The Senior Contracts Manager will also be responsible for collaborating with functional counterparts across Seneca, contributing to key cross-functional projects, and developing other members of the Seneca CLEC team.

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Mentor Mission Services sector contracting team that supports a rapidly growing federal government contracting professional services portfolio.
  • Negotiate and manage SNG's contracting and subcontracting efforts with end clients and third parties, which may include:
    • U.S. federal government
    • Government contractors
    • Commercial, non-profit, or university partners
  • Draft documents related to SNG's proposal, teaming, and subcontracting.
  • Serve as subject matter expert for pre-award through post-award contract management, contracting risk reviews, and business development strategy discussions.
  • Assist technical teams in negotiations, contract management, and subcontracting.
  • Review solicitations (RFPs/RFIs) to ensure compliance with requirements.
  • Resolve contracting issues in negotiation with government contracting officers and technical leadership.
  • Work with program managers to identify and manage contract terms from proposal stage to project close-out, including timely submittal of required contract reports (e.g., limitation of funds, deliverable tracking, IP reports, and government property, as applicable).
    • Federal government prime contract compliance, including NAICS, size standards, limitations on subcontracting, FAR compliance, nonmanufacturing rule, contract/task order funding, etc.
    • Subcontract management, including subcontracts, NDAs, teaming agreements, compliance with insurance requirements, task order funding, etc.
